SpidaCalc
Structural Analysis Software
FEA (Finite Element Analysis) Pole and all Guys, Anchors analyzed All NESC load cases simulated
Existing plant evaluation or new designs Load results are stored with the asset data Company utilizations displayed as % of load
Design Analysis
Finite Element Analysis (FEA) Engine
Applied winds rotated 360 to pinpoint potential design problems for each element
Pole
Entire pole length analyzed Flexible pole model Secondary moments (P-Delta) optional

MILSOFT Field Engineering Integration Work Uses SpidaCalc Calculation Engine Gives stakers a new, additional perspective
Structural and Clearance Analysis Indirect QC of work Optimization Tools
Representation of Loading Results Arrows showing the wind direction of the load and a resultant force, provide visual cues of pole loading magnitude The circle and loading arrow change to red on failed poles
Graphical Interface Additional data such as Joint Use can be added in the graphical interface. Attachment heights can be adjusted for a more accurate model
Loading Results
Detailed look at the analysis results for the pole, guy, and anchor
